Climate Challenge: 1.5 Degrees Films invites people to make 90-second films to share their thoughts and ideas about climate change and how it is affecting us as individuals, our surroundings, families and communities. Youth groups, schools, community organisations, activist groups and individuals are all encouraged to take part in the Climate Challenge: 1.5 Degrees Films project.

Regardless of background, age or filmmaking experience, anyone can submit a film to the Challenge.

There are resources available to help groups get started. Groups and organisations, such as Community Groups, Youth Groups, Environmental Groups, Activist Groups and Arts Groups, can register for Free Online Workshops where a group representative will receive filmmaking and climate literacy training.
